云虚拟主机是一种基于云计算技术的虚拟化服务器,它将物理服务器划分为多个独立的虚拟服务器,每个虚拟服务器都可以独立运行操作系统和应用程序。云虚拟主机具有弹性扩展、高可用性、易管理等优点。
云虚拟主机通常分为共享型、独立型和GPU加速型等类型,不同类型适用于不同的应用场景。
选择云虚拟主机的大小需要考虑以下几个因素:
问题1:选择的云虚拟主机性能不足
原因:选择的配置过低,无法满足业务需求。
解决方法:
问题2:流量超出预期
原因:未准确预估网站流量,导致带宽不足。
解决方法:
问题3:安全性问题
原因:未采取足够的安全措施,导致数据泄露或被攻击。
解决方法:
以下是一个简单的Python脚本,用于监控服务器性能并调整配置:
import psutil
import time
def monitor_server():
cpu_percent = psutil.cpu_percent(interval=1)
memory_percent = psutil.virtual_memory().percent
disk_usage = psutil.disk_usage('/').percent
print(f"CPU: {cpu_percent}%, Memory: {memory_percent}%, Disk: {disk_usage}%")
def adjust_config():
# 根据监控数据调整配置的逻辑
pass
if __name__ == "__main__":
while True:
monitor_server()
time.sleep(60)
通过以上信息,您可以更好地了解云虚拟主机的选择和配置,确保满足您的业务需求。
领取专属 10元无门槛券
手把手带您无忧上云